Housed in a 5 gallon tote with airholes my throng of isopods wanted an upgrade. This one fits my standards after too many attempts at getting them a waterfall but also dumby proofing it to make sure they didn’t drown I scrapped that idea and went back to my roots with a no bells and whistles 12g terrarium. I want to wait a couple weeks to let these plants grow in and im also shipping some tropical mosses in to help hold humidity and finish the look. I am not sure the ID on this philodendron it is a rescue and just labeled ‘fancy philo’ at my LGS. Honestly looks good and the roots were in great shape albeit a little thirsty. I will be adding a canopy over the top of this aquarium to prevent escapes. The isopods can’t climb glass so I just gotta make sure no daredevils skydive from the top of the philo background: peacock plant foreground: white vein nerve plant ‘Blue peperomia’ is what this climber was labeled as.
